    Uses for homemade taco seasoning

    This homemade seasoning is wonderful! It can be used on your favorite meat or even tofu!

    Season your veggies for fajitas, flavor chicken tortilla soup, or of course the ground beef for your taco night!

    This seasoning is a staple for all kitchens, and making it yourself is so much more satisfying than buying it at a store. You can use this in a variety of different meals, so make a double batch. You will love it!

    Storing Taco Seasoning:

    To store this you want to place it in an airtight container and in your pantry.

    I recommend keeping the seasoning mix for around 6 months.

    Once thing to keep in mind with spices and seasoning is that they typically do not "go bad."

    Spices typically can last anywhere from 1-3 years, but I recommend remixing a new batch every 6 months.

    Spicing up your taco seasoning:

    If you like a little more heat in your taco seasoning add some crushed red pepper flakes.

    This will definitely spice up your taco seasoning.

    There are also different levels of heat in chili powder that can add more heat. For a slightly different flavor try adding some cajun seasoning to it as well.

    Easy Homemade Taco Seasoning

    Jennie Duncan
    I love taco recipes! I make a taco-style recipe at least once a week and love adding my homemade taco seasoning. This Easy Homemade Taco Seasoning is made with simple seasonings you probably already have in your pantry. 
    Print Recipe Pin Recipe
    Prep Time 5 mins
    Total Time 5 mins
    Course Main Course
    Cuisine American
    Servings 18 servings
    Calories 11 kcal

    Ingredients
      

    • 2 ½ tablespoon cumin
    • ½ cup chili powder
    • 2 tablespoon garlic (I used dried minced but garlic powder would also work)
    • ¼ cup onion powder
    • 1 tablespoon paprika
    • 1 tablespoon salt
    • 1 tablespoon pepper

    Instructions
     

    • Place all seasonings into a container and use a fork to mix together. Place in an airtight container and store in a dry place.
